During the development of towns, there are constant changes in the way of land use. This paper took a town in Hebei province as an example, obtained its remote sensing data, analyzed the characteristics of land use changes and the impact on ecological protection in the area between 2013 and 2020, and calculated the degree of diversity, dynamic degree, and ecological index. The results showed that from 2013 to 2020, the area of the cultivated land in the town decreased by 423.33 km2, the area of the forest land decreased by 25.15 km2, but the area of the construction land increased by 454.743 km2; the degree of diversity was relatively stable, the overall dynamic degree was 0.24%, the fragmentation and separation degrees decreased; the cultivated and construction lands changed most. This study can provide a reference for the subsequent land use planning of this town.
